Exploring the Ap9604: A Professional Overview

In the realm of modern electronics, efficient power management is essential for maintaining system reliability and performance. The Ap9604, an advanced device within this sector, plays a crucial role in managing power distribution and consumption across various systems. Developed by APC, a subsidiary of Schneider Electric known for its innovative solutions, the Ap9604 is tailored to meet the demands of professional environments requiring precise power monitoring and management capabilities. Effective power management not only ensures longevity and durability of the equipment but also enhances overall operational performance. In an economy that increasingly leans on uninterrupted power supply and cost-effective energy usage, the role of devices like the Ap9604 becomes even more significant, making its exploration worthwhile.

Key Features of the Ap9604

  • Real-Time Monitoring: The Ap9604 provides real-time data on power usage, offering insights into power distribution patterns and enabling informed decisions. Through its intuitive user interface, professionals can easily access data metrics, resulting in quicker assessments and interventions.
  • Remote Management: Its capability to manage power remotely ensures that professionals can handle issues promptly, regardless of their location. This is particularly advantageous for managers overseeing multiple sites or those who travel frequently, allowing for constant oversight and control.
  • Compatibility and Integration: Designed to integrate seamlessly with existing systems, the Ap9604 enhances operational efficiency without the need for extensive modifications. The plug-and-play functionality means less installation time and less workforce disruption.
  • Data Logging: By logging data over time, it helps identify patterns and predict potential future challenges, aiding in preventive maintenance efforts. This continuous data collection assists in making informed decisions about system upgrades and necessary repairs.
  • User-Friendly Interface: The Ap9604 comes with a user-friendly interface that simplifies navigation and operation, allowing even non-technical staff to monitor power conditions effectively and respond to alerts.
  • Alert System: A built-in alert system ensures that users are notified in real-time of any discrepancies from normal operating levels, enabling swift corrective actions to be taken.
  • Reduced Environmental Impact: By optimizing energy consumption, the Ap9604 contributes to reduced carbon footprints and overall environmental impact, aligning with global sustainability goals.
